I load geocaches on my 1450 as poi so I Can see them as i travel. I don't like to use the tourguide because if I am traveling thru a city it has locked up on me . I would just like for them to show up on the map but here is the problem at low speed it works just fine but at hwy speed they never show up am I doing something wrong? it use to work on my TomTom
Is this while you are
Is this while you are navigating a route or just while driving around? If the former, you're doing nothing wrong because the units are designed to zoom in or out automatically based upon the speed you are traveling. If the latter, adjust your zoom before you travel, but be aware that the maximum zoom level you can use and still have the icons appear is 300 feet.

The Tour Guide option is the only one that will alert you if you're driving near a cache. If you save them to favourites, they will appear on the map.
Have you tried paperless geocaching? I found it useful when I used my nuvi (I now use an app on my phone).
